Courage is not earned. Courage is not given. Courage is not found. Courage is created.


Courage is created when you choose to move forward anyway. So where is God inviting you to be courageous today?


God told Joshua, “Be strong and of good courage.” See that word, “Be”? That’s the real deal.


And here’s the truth: the more you take steps of courage, the smaller your fears become.


But if you never take those steps, your fears remain a giant in your mind, uncontested, unchallenged, and unshrinking.


A life of purpose always faces pushback. Challenges will come, planned and unplanned opposition will raise its voice.


Even well-intentioned people may not understand the purpose of your life. 


Jesus said, “The time is coming that whoever kills you (kills your vision, kills your conviction, kills your focus, kills your dream, kills your passion, kills your courage) will think that he offers service to God” (John 16:2).


Some may think you should blend in and do what everyone else does. They don’t understand your dedication.


To them, no one cares deeply or takes things seriously, so they wonder why you shouldn’t.


Their attitude is simple: “Eat and drink, for tomorrow we die” (1 Corinthians 15:32). Nehemiah faced similar challenges.


When he stood to rebuild the broken walls of Jerusalem, envious and unbelieving voices stirred up opposition and poisoned the minds of some dwellers in the city against him.


Their goal? To make him afraid (Nehemiah 4:11). But Nehemiah did not doubt his resolve, nor did he question his mission.


He did not shrink from the vision of seeing the walls completed and the city secured. He boldly asked, “Should such a man as I run away?” (Nehemiah 6:11).


There was no reason to stop the work. There was no other work to do at such a time as this. Only cowards flee. 


If you flee at all, flee towards your vision. If you change at all, let it be for growth, not convenience. 


If you shift direction, let it be to become more effective, not to please distractors who are only watching, hoping you will fall or quit.


Let not your hands be slack. Stay true to what matters. When opposition rises, double down. When bullies bark, stand tall.


When fear knocks, keep moving. Bullies back down when boldness shows up.


Reflection Question: In what areas of your life do you need courage right now?
